Transaction 301c9664faf8e596ce28b687fca66096abe83cddfd58d87be565271d16d2a22e
1 Input
2 Outputs
- 301c9664faf8e596ce28b687fca66096abe83cddfd58d87be565271d16d2a22e:0
- 301c9664faf8e596ce28b687fca66096abe83cddfd58d87be565271d16d2a22e:1
value 20590000
address 1CFvmKmahkrvo4w2Au42wZP3FHEc96Zwj9
value 29170711
address 19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V